Bill Seeks to Remove Fish and Wildlife from Missouri River Management
May 22, 2013 - (0) commentsA bill introduced in the House of Representatives last month (HR 1460) seeks to remove fish and wildlife from the list of eight congressionally mandated management purposes along the Missouri River Mainstem Reservoir System. The bill, sponsored by Congressmen Graves […]

Update — Elephant Security Restored After Political Upheaval
May 20, 2013 - (0) commentsEndangered forest elephants (Loxodonta cyclotis) in the Central African Republic (CAR) are safe once again. CAR security forces returned to Dzanga-Sangha National Park (DSNP) after they were expelled in April by poachers and violence escalated in the region following the […]
